#2e0805 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2e0805 is composed of 18% red, 3.1%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.6% magenta, 89.1% yellow and 82% black. It has a hue angle of 4.4 degrees, a saturation of 80.4% and a lightness of 10%. #2e0805 color hex could be obtained by blending #5c100a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

● #2e0805 color description : Very dark (mostly black) red.
#2e0805 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2e0805 has RGB values of R:46, G:8,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.89, K:0.82. Its decimal value is 3016709.

Shades and Tints of #2e0805
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0201 is the darkest color, while #fef8f8 is the lightest one.
